I had to reattach my 348 mirror once. One morning I jumped in the car and saw the rear view mirror laying on the floor. I ordered the adhesive pad from Ferrari. When it arrived, it was all cracked and rotten from age. Porsche used the exact same pad on the 914. I would suggest you go to your local Porsche dealer and have them get you one. I don't think the mirror came apart from its base. Make sure to remove all of the old adhesive off the windshield and base. Use a blade to scrape the mirror base clean, then follow up with some solvent. Once it's completely clean and dry, apply the new adhesive pad to the mirror base. I put some blue painters tape on the windshield to locate where the perimeter of the mirror base should go. Then simply press firmly into place.
